Osalp

OSALP es un proyecto diseñado para implementar un conjunto de clases de clase mundial en C ++ que manejarán todas las funciones de audio.
Descargar ahora

Osalp Clasificación y resumen

Anuncio publicitario

  • Rating:
  • Licencia:
  • LGPL
  • Precio:
  • FREE
  • Nombre del editor:
  • Darrick Servis
  • Sitio web del editor:

Osalp Etiquetas


Osalp Descripción

OSALP es un proyecto diseñado para implementar un conjunto de clases de clase mundial en C ++ que manejarán todas las funciones de audio. OSALP es un proyecto diseñado para implementar un conjunto de clases de clase mundial en C ++ que manejarán todas las funciones de audio que se gustaría que uno quiera. Está diseñado para ser multiplataforma con plataformas basadas en UNIX como la base. Este proyecto aún está en la fase de código beta y ahora está disponible una versión beta que ilustrará la potencia y la flexibilidad. Esta versión admite el dispositivo de audio Linux (OSS), dispositivo de audio Solaris SPARC, dispositivo de audio FreeBSD (OSS), WAV, AU, AIFF, AIFC, MP3 y numerosos formatos. Es importante tener en cuenta que esta no es una aplicación, sino Biblioteca de C ++ que otros pueden usar para crear una aplicación de audio o para agregar capacidades de audio con facilidad a una aplicación existente. Osalp fue diseñado originalmente y desarrollado por Bruce Forsberg fuera de la necesidad de administrar y editar archivos de sonido grandes de manera simple. Actualmente, el proyecto está siendo mantenido por Darrick Servis. La biblioteca se construye en un conjunto de clases básicas que proporcionan la funcionalidad básica. Las nuevas clases para operar en los datos se derivan de estas clases. Estas clases proporcionan un potente proceso de encadenamiento. Esto permite que uno construya una cadena de audio, como uno se construiría con los bloques de construcción. Los datos de audio se encapsulan en una sola clase. Esto permite que uno maneje las conversiones de datos en un solo lugar. Hay una clase base de archivos (AFLIBFILE) que define la API para cualquier dispositivo o clases de archivos que se deben desarrollar. Se implementan como objetos compartidos cargados dinámicamente para que se puedan agregar nuevos tipos de archivos sin recomponer la biblioteca de la base o la necesidad de vincularlos a una aplicación. Esto permitirá a terceros apoyar a sus formatos propietarios como un dispositivo de "módulos complementarios" binarios y dispositivos FreeBSD (OSS), dispositivo AFLIBDEVFILESOLARIS SPARC - AFLIBSOLARISPARCDEVFILEWAV (LINEAL, MU-Derecho, A-Derecho) - Aflibwavfileau (lineal, Derecho MU, AFLIBAUFILEAFC - AFLIBAIFCFILEIFC - AFLIBAIFFFILEFFILEMP3 Uso del codificador LAME - AFLIBLAMEFILEMP3 Uso del codificador de cuchillas - lector AFLIBBLADEFILEMP3 Uso de la biblioteca de Splay - Lector AFLIBMPGFILEMP3 Uso del ejecutable MPG123 - Interfaz de biblioteca AFLIBMPG123FILESOX (admite la mayoría de los formatos admitidos Por la biblioteca de herramientas de sonido de SOX - AflibsoxFileRentamente se encuentran varias clases de trabajadores. Estas son las clases que realmente hacen el trabajo. Estas clases no están vinculadas a ninguna GUI, pero son gui neutro. Esto permite a los desarrolladores escribir código usando la GUI de su elección. . Convertidor de tasas de muestra de audio - Aflibaudiosampleratecvtaudio Cambio de tono - Fuente de prueba Aflibaudiopitchaudio - AflibaudioconstantsRcaudio Edición - Registro de temporizador AflibaudioEditaudio ING - AFLIBAUDIORECORECTORAUTIO VU METER Y PANTALLA DE SPECTRUMA - AFLIBAUDIOSPECTRAUMANDIA MEZCLA - FILTRO DE AFLIBAUDIOTIMIXERBUTTWORTH - AFLIBAUDIOBWFILTERREADERO DE DATOS DE AUDIO DE LA MEMORIA - AFLIBAUDIOTOMEMIANDIBLICIONES DATOS DE AUDIO DE LOS AFLIBAUDIOTOMEMIANDREADREADOS Y ESCRIBIR LOS AFLIBAUDIOFILETHERÁ CLASES DE AFLIBAUDIOFILETHA Estos no son parte de la cadena de audio principal, pero es probable que la mayoría de las aplicaciones de audio necesitan o se usen indirectamente por las clases de trabajadores. FFT - AFLIBFFTUSER MEDIO AMBIENTE DE ALMACENAMIENTO Y RETURNO - DATOS DE MUESTRA DE AFLIBENVFILEAUDIO - AFLIBSAMPLEDATEAMAME Tasa de conversión - AflibConverter


Osalp Software relacionado

libgnurdf

Libgnurdf es una biblioteca GNUPDATE RDF que proporciona acceso rápido y fácil a los archivos RDF (Formato de descripción de recursos XML). ...

105

Descargar

Isq

ISQ (le pregunto) es una biblioteca de extensión de etiqueta que le ayuda a hacer formularios HTML. ...

153

Descargar

libmemory

Libmemory Library proporciona una implementación de M.M. Algoritmo de reclamación de memoria segura de Micheal en C. ...

138

Descargar